当前位置:首页 > 编程笔记 > 正文
已解决

ubuntu20.04安装MySQL8、MySQL服务管理、mysql8卸载

来自网友在路上 135835提问 提问时间:2023-10-25 22:53:28阅读次数: 35

最佳答案 问答题库358位专家为你答疑解惑

ubuntu20.04安装MySQL8

#更新源
sudo apt-get update
#安装
sudo apt-get install mysql-server

MySQL服务管理

# 查看服务状态
sudo service mysql status
# 启动服务
sudo service mysql start
# 停止服务
sudo service mysql stop
# 重启服务
sudo service mysql restart

登录

查看密码使用这条查看:
sudo cat /etc/mysql/debian.cnf-- 之后把你的密码复制下拉

使用默认账户登录

mysql -u debian-sys-maint -p或直接进入mysqlsudo mysql

创建新用户

因为尝试修改了root账户的密码似乎不起作用,于是创建一个新的账户来作为日常使用
新建账户
新建一个root用户,密码为rootcreate user 'root'@'%' identified by 'root';

授权

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' WITH GRANT OPTION;
FLUSH PRIVILEGES;

重置密码

重置root账户密码为passwordSET PASSWORD FOR root@'localhost' = PASSWORD('password');

mysql8卸载

#查看是否安装mysql
mysql --version
#若结果显示类似于:mysql  Ver 8.0.34-0ubuntu0.20.04.1 for Linux on x86_64 ((Ubuntu))。表示你的系统安装过,先卸载#先暂停服务
sudo systemctl stop mysql#卸载
sudo apt remove --purge mysql-server mysql-client mysql-common mysql-server-core-* mysql-client-core-*#删除相关文件
sudo rm -rf /etc/mysql /var/lib/mysql /var/log/mysql#清除残留文件
sudo apt autoremovesudo apt autoclean#删除mysql用户和用户组
sudo deluser mysql
sudo delgroup mysql
sudo groupdel mysql#查看是否删除成功
mysql --version
#结果显示找不到mysql服务表示卸载成功
查看全文

99%的人还看了

猜你感兴趣

版权申明

本文"ubuntu20.04安装MySQL8、MySQL服务管理、mysql8卸载":http://eshow365.cn/6-24524-0.html 内容来自互联网,请自行判断内容的正确性。如有侵权请联系我们,立即删除!